Chinese man with a bird
Manufactory Meissen Manufactory German
Attributed to George Fritzsche German
Like the other figure in this case, this group represents an early example of porcelain sculpture at Meissen. It may have been intended to be fitted with gilt bronze mounts, as several other examples of this group have been embellished in this manner, including one in the Linsky Collection in this Museum (1982.60.256).
